F1 rookie handed Ferrari debut in Bahrain

Charles Leclerc is set to miss part of the Bahrain Grand Prix weekend for Ferrari.

Ferrari has announced that protege Dino Beganovic is set to make his F1 debut in practice for the Bahrain Grand Prix. 

New rules for the 2025 season mean each regular race driver must hand their car over twice to a rookie driver, instead of just for a single time, in practice, with Ferrari the first team to confirm it is using one of the four required slots. 

Beganovic will step into Charles Leclerc's SF-25 alongside Lewis Hamilton, as he makes his F1 weekend debut. 

The Swedish-Bosnian will dovetail those duties with the F2 support event, as he embarks on his first full season in the second rung on the ladder with the Hitech squad.

In the season-opener, he finished 14th in the first race, before the feature was cancelled due to heavy rain. 

Beganovic won two races in 2024 FIA F3 and is the 2022 FRECA champion.
